Science tells us early learning is critically important, yet somehow it’s both remarkably expensive and those doing it are massively underpaid. There’s a huge divide in how we think about education before age 5 and after, and that needs to change. Rachel Giannini, childhood specialist and “a preschool teacher’s preschool teacher”, joins us to talk about the state of early education in the US today, the art of working well with small humans, and what families should look for in an early childhood center.
